Languages of IHEA Publications

IHEA currently offers multicultural, multilingual health education material in nearly 60 languages to educate immigrants and other minorities, as well their service and health providers, on prevention and early detection of nearly a dozen lethal diseases.

Besides saving lives, our goal is to promote cultural competency, cultural diversity and cultural sensitivity in healthcare through overcoming cultural and linguistic barriers and training healthcare workers and other professionals on how to do the same.
